Sonadinna


A devaputta who had seven mansions in TÄvatiṃsa. King Nimi saw these on his visit to Sakka, and MÄtali explained to him that Sonadinna had been a householder in a KÄsi village in the time of Kassapa Buddha and had built hermitages for holy men, providing them with all necessities. J.vi.118f.
